VANDALISM POSTPONES PORTSLADE'S OPENER

PORTSLADE'S scheduled home game with Middleton was postponed on Saturday after vandalism to the wicket. On Friday evening, a tap near the square was turned on which made the whole wicket and outfield unplayable.

Portslade captain Jamie Howick said: "The whole square was sodden and was still wet two hours after play was due to begin. Both ourselves and Middleton will write a letter to the Invitation League asking them if we can play this game at the end of the season."
